The clock had just struck midnight when the small dark figure climbed out of the window.
It slid shut and he darted across the clearing on the West side of the old cottage.
After reaching the Forest line he stopped. A clanging sound came from the bag as he set it down.
Pulling a silver serving dish from the sack he examines it.
Suddenly, yelling brakes out as lamps are lit in the cottage he had just visited. Quickly he placed the dish into the sack, heaved it over his shoulder and headed west towards Rhydin.

Eric stood at the End of the West clearing with a banana held loosely in his left hand. Angrily he placed it in his saddle bag and mounted his horse.
"Ha" he pounded his heals into the horses side three times and it bolted west to Rhydin, the only place he could think for this Thief to go.
The only thing on his mind was to reap his vengeance upon the one who stole the only thing he held of value.
